ANRA Technologies announced a strategic partnership with Flyby Guys, a leader in enterprise drone services. This collaboration is set to enhance ANRA capabilities in providing cutting-edge airspace management and operational services across Europe and beyond. With a strong presence in the U.S., India, the UK, and Europe, ANRA Technologies has established itself as a leader in UTM, offering comprehensive solutions for airspace management, data services, and enterprise support. The partnership with Flyby Guys marks a significant milestone in ANRA' expansion strategy, particularly in the European market.

Stephen Sutton, CEO of Flyby Guys commented: "We are thrilled to partner with ANRA Technologies. Our combined expertise will enable us to push the boundaries of what’s possible in drone operations and UTM services. We look forward to working together to shape the future of the drone industry in Europe and beyond."

Amit Ganjoo, CEO of ANRA Technologies stated: "Collaborating with Flyby Guys is an important step in our strategy to expand our footprint in Europe. Their operational excellence and deep understanding of the global drone landscape perfectly complement our mission to deliver world-class UTM solutions. Together, we are poised to lead the way in transforming airspace management and drone operations across the region."

Flyby Guys, headquartered in Helsinki, Finland, has built a strong reputation as a premier drone operator with extensive global experience. Their operations span across Asia, the Middle East, Africa, and Europe, providing unparalleled drone operations and project management expertise. This partnership will leverage Flyby Guys' vast operational experience to bolster ANRA's mission of advancing U-space technology and drone services across Europe.

This strategic alliance will empower both companies to deliver innovative solutions, ensuring the safe and efficient integration of drones into European airspace while setting new standards for operational excellence.
